Key solar panel repair statistics:

  • Solar panels last 25 to 30 years on average
  • Inverters typically require replacement after 10 to 15 years
  • 80% of solar system downtime results from inverter failures
  • Panel degradation rates average 0.5% to 1% annually
  • Most repair issues can be resolved quickly when addressed early

Common causes requiring solar panel repair:

  • Inverter component failures from age or power surges
  • Communication disruptions between monitoring systems and equipment
  • Weather damage including hail impact, wind stress, or thermal cycling
  • Mounting hardware loosening from vibrations or corrosion
  • Individual panel defects from microcracks or moisture intrusion

6 Critical Warning Signs Your Solar System Requires Professional Repair

Solar modules typically last 25 to 30 years, but harsh weather, natural wear, and equipment failure can reduce system efficiency over time. Without regular monitoring, issues often go unnoticed until electric bills spike or solar monitoring systems flag problems.

Most solar problems receive quick and affordable fixes with qualified solar repair services. The following six warning signs indicate when professional solar repair and maintenance become necessary, along with helpful troubleshooting tips before scheduling service.

1. Declining Energy Output From Your Solar Array

A noticeable drop in energy production serves as the most obvious warning sign. When electricity bills increase or monitoring apps show reduced power generation, something likely interferes with system performance.

Possible causes include:

  • Shading from trees or new structures
  • Dirty or debris-covered panels
  • Damaged or aging wiring and connectors
  • Failed panels or inverter issues

After ruling out temporary shading or weather changes, solar technicians run full diagnostics to identify issues. Solar panel repair or maintenance often restores systems to original performance levels.

2. System Monitoring Data Shows Connectivity Failures

Solar monitoring systems track system performance effectively. When apps fail to update or show inconsistent data, solar systems likely experience trouble communicating with inverters or utility grids.

Common signs include:

  • Gaps in performance data
  • Offline or disconnected status
  • Unusual spikes or drops in production

These symptoms point to inverter communication problems or system-wide issues. If resets fail to resolve problems, solar system checkups or solar inverter repairs become necessary.

3. Error Codes and Red Flashing Lights on Your Inverter

Inverters convert direct current (DC) from panels into usable alternating current (AC) for homes. When inverters malfunction, systems cannot deliver power effectively.

Watch for these indicators:

  • Red or blinking status lights
  • No lights at all
  • Frequent error codes or fault messages

Each inverter brand uses different indicators, but flashing red lights or inverter fault codes typically signal electrical or component failure. These common issues require qualified technician expertise for proper solar inverter repair.

4. Physical Damage and Discoloration on Panel Surfaces

Physical damage to solar panels occurs more frequently than many homeowners realize. Hail, high winds, fallen branches, or thermal cycling over time compromise panel integrity and reduce efficiency.

Damaged solar panels disrupt electrical flow, causing performance drops or complete shutdowns. Visual inspections often reveal underlying issues affecting system performance.

Signs of solar panel damage include:

  • Cracked or shattered glass allowing moisture entry
  • Delamination or peeling between panel layers
  • Discoloration or yellow/brown spots indicating overheating or moisture intrusion
  • Hotspots or visible burn marks near wiring, connectors, or junction boxes
  • Corrosion on metal framing or around electrical contacts

When solar inverters malfunction or monitoring systems show output drops from specific panels, visible damage may cause voltage mismatches or safety shutdowns within inverter systems.

5. Unexpected Increases in Monthly Electric Bills

Sudden electricity bill increases provide clear signs that solar energy systems malfunction. When solar panels reduce monthly utility costs as designed, unexpected spikes indicate panels fail to work properly or produce insufficient power to offset energy usage.

Several common issues cause performance drops:

  • Solar inverter failures or intermittent operation
  • Solar panels underperforming due to age, damage, or manufacturing defects
  • System shading from new tree growth or debris buildup
  • Disconnected or disabled system components after storms or electrical issues

Comparing recent utility bills to system monitoring app data helps identify problems. When solar production numbers run low or apps show no data, professional solar panel repair becomes necessary. Early issue identification prevents further performance losses and protects long-term savings.

6. Orphaned Systems From Defunct Solar Installation Companies

Recent years have seen numerous solar installation companies close, leaving homeowners with orphaned solar systems and limited support options. When solar panels malfunction, solar inverters stop responding, or monitoring systems go dark without installer support, professional repair services become essential.

Homeowners with orphaned systems often face:

  • No warranty support for equipment or workmanship
  • Inverter error codes common with various systems
  • Difficulty troubleshooting or resetting systems without technical guidance
  • Inability to reach original installers for basic maintenance or repairs

Service providers specializing in orphaned system support offer nationwide solar panel repair, inverter troubleshooting, and full diagnostic services to restore system functionality. Even for systems several years old, many issues remain fixable.

When solar panels fail to produce adequate electricity or stop working entirely, professional system checkups determine whether minor adjustments or extensive repairs are needed. Scheduling solar system evaluations quickly protects investments and prevents months of lost production.

Frequently Diagnosed Solar System Problems Requiring Professional Attention

As solar systems age or encounter environmental stress, performance issues surface regularly. Storm damage, installation shortcuts, or wear and tear lead to solar panels malfunctioning, reduced output, or complete system shutdowns. Professional repair services help homeowners and installers identify and fix issues efficiently.

Some situations require simple adjustments. Others demand full component replacements, especially when solar inverters malfunction or solar panels produce insufficient power.

Common solar panel repair and maintenance problems include:

Complete Inverter System Breakdowns

Solar inverters convert DC electricity from panels into AC power for homes. When solar inverters malfunction, panels might generate energy, but none reaches homes or utility grids. Inverter issues rank among top reasons customers seek solar repair services.

Common inverter problems include:

  • Age-related component wear (especially after 10+ years)
  • Connectivity issues in various systems
  • Internal faults due to power surges or overheating

While most inverters carry manufacturer warranties, labor and troubleshooting often lack coverage. Professional solar repair services determine warranty eligibility and handle safe installation and reconnection.

Monitoring System Connectivity Disruptions

When solar monitoring systems stop reporting data, determining whether systems function properly becomes difficult. Many homeowners only discover solar panel malfunctions through higher-than-expected utility bills, often because monitoring platforms stopped updating.

Modern solar systems rely on apps and platforms like various monitoring dashboards to track energy production. When these tools go offline, visibility into power production disappears.

Common causes of solar monitoring problems include:

  • Wi-Fi signal loss or router reconfigurations
  • Incomplete firmware updates disconnecting devices
  • Hardware failure in communication gateways
  • Solar inverter malfunctions interrupting monitoring data entirely

When apps fail to update or monitoring portals show missing data, problems likely exist. Solar panel repair technicians test system connectivity, reboot communication devices, and confirm actual power generation. This step proves important when determining why solar panels produce insufficient power.

Structural Issues With Mounting Hardware

Solar panels depend on racking and mounting hardware for long-term structural stability. Weather, vibrations, and external roof work can loosen these supports over time, leading to visible misalignment or potential damage. Crooked panels or gaps between rails signal the need for solar repair and maintenance inspection.

Frequent racking and mounting issues include:

  • Loose rails, brackets, or clamps
  • Sagging panel rows due to uneven load distribution
  • Corroded or missing bolts, especially in coastal or snowy regions

These problems strain wiring, increase water intrusion risks, or reduce solar panel efficiency by misaligning their angle to the sun. Solar technicians inspect and secure racking systems, preventing further damage and restoring safe operation.

Individual Panel Degradation and Defects

Solar panels built to last 25+ years remain vulnerable to damage. When solar panels malfunction or inverters show production drops on specific array sections, issues may isolate to one or more panels.

Typical panel level issues include:

  • Cracked or broken glass from hail or debris impact
  • Hotspots caused by internal cell damage or prolonged shading
  • Microcracks developing over time and reducing power output
  • Delamination or water ingress leading to corrosion or electrical shorts

These issues often cause reduced power in panel strings or alerts on monitoring platforms. Systems using optimizers or microinverters help pinpoint exactly which panels are affected.

During solar panel repair services, technicians use thermal cameras, voltage meters, and panel level monitoring tools to identify root causes. Replacing single damaged panels or repairing faults restores system performance and prevents further degradation.

FAQs

How much does solar panel repair typically cost?

Solar panel repair costs vary significantly based on the specific issue and required solution. Minor repairs like resetting inverters or cleaning monitoring equipment may cost a few hundred dollars for service calls.

Component replacements prove more expensive, with inverter replacements ranging from $1,000 to $3,000 depending on system size and inverter type. Panel replacements typically cost $200 to $500 per panel including labor.

Warranty coverage often reduces out of pocket expenses by covering equipment costs, though labor and shipping charges frequently remain the homeowner's responsibility. Professional diagnostic services help identify exact issues and provide accurate repair cost estimates before work begins.

Can I repair solar panels myself or do I need a professional?

Solar panel systems involve high voltage DC electricity and complex electrical components that present serious safety risks without proper training and equipment. Professional solar technicians possess specialized knowledge, safety equipment, diagnostic tools, and licensing required for safe repairs.

DIY repairs risk electrical shock, system damage, warranty voiding, and code violations. Simple maintenance tasks like cleaning panels or checking monitoring apps remain safe for homeowners, but actual repairs involving electrical components, inverters, or panel replacements require qualified professionals.

Additionally, many equipment warranties become void if unauthorized individuals perform repairs, making professional service essential for protecting both safety and investment.

How often should I have my solar system inspected for potential problems?

Annual professional inspections provide optimal preventive maintenance for solar energy systems. These yearly checkups allow technicians to identify developing issues before they cause system failures or significant production losses.

Homeowners should also perform monthly visual inspections checking for visible damage, debris accumulation, monitoring system alerts, and production data anomalies. Systems in harsh climates with frequent storms, heavy snow, or extreme temperatures may benefit from more frequent professional inspections.

After severe weather events like hailstorms or high winds, immediate inspections help identify damage requiring prompt repair. Regular monitoring app reviews between inspections enable early detection of performance drops or communication failures.

What happens if my solar installer went out of business and my system needs repairs?

Homeowners with orphaned solar systems from defunct installers still have repair options available. Independent solar service providers specialize in supporting systems regardless of original installer status.

Equipment warranties from manufacturers often remain valid even when installers close, though homeowners become responsible for coordinating warranty claims and finding qualified technicians for installation. Professional solar repair companies can assess system issues, determine warranty eligibility, process manufacturer claims, and perform necessary repairs or replacements.

Documentation including system specifications, equipment serial numbers, and original installation records helps facilitate repairs when original installers are unavailable.

Will my solar panel warranty cover repair costs?

Solar panel warranties typically include both equipment and performance coverage, but understanding specific terms proves essential. Equipment warranties covering manufacturing defects usually last 10 to 25 years and cover replacement parts for failed components.

However, most equipment warranties exclude labor costs, shipping charges, and service call fees. Performance warranties guarantee minimum production levels over 25 to 30 years, protecting against excessive degradation. Inverter warranties range from 5 to 25 years depending on type and manufacturer.

When warranty covered failures occur, homeowners typically pay for diagnostic services, labor for removal and installation, and shipping costs even when equipment replacement is free. Reviewing warranty documentation before repairs helps clarify coverage and out of pocket expenses.

How long does it take to repair a solar panel system?

Solar panel repair timelines depend on problem complexity and parts availability. Simple fixes like inverter resets, monitoring system reboots, or minor wiring repairs often complete within a single service visit lasting a few hours.

Component replacements requiring equipment orders extend repair timelines significantly. Inverter replacements may take one to three weeks when units require shipping from manufacturers. Panel replacements follow similar timelines depending on specific panel model availability.

Systems with multiple issues or complex problems requiring extensive diagnostics may need several days for complete repair. Warranty claims add processing time as manufacturers review documentation before approving replacements.

Professional repair services provide estimated timelines after initial diagnostics, helping homeowners understand expected system downtime and production losses during repair periods.
